Grasping H2O Destruction


H2O destruction can happen from various origins, including organic catastrophes, water handling failures, or people’s faults. Recognizing the fundamental source is crucial for successful restoration. When water penetrates a building, it can leak into walls, floors, and interiors, creating an space conducive to fungus growth and structural deterioration. Identifying the origin and degree of the water intrusion is the initial step in the rehabilitation procedure.


The effects of H2O damage can differ, according to factors such as the duration of exposure, the materials affected, and the cleanliness of the H2O origin. Clear water from a broken pipe poses distinct hazards compared to tainted H2O from a waste backup. Timely action is crucial; the longer water sits, the greater the damage becomes, which can result in expensive restorations and health hazards for residents.

Preventive Measures Post-Cleanup


Following a comprehensive cleanup, implementing protective measures is crucial to avoid future water damage. One of the most effective measures is to ensure proper drainage throughout your property. This includes frequently cleaning gutters and downspouts to reduce clogs that can lead to surplus water and water pooling around the foundation. Additionally, consider landscaping adjustments that direct water off the home, such as sloping lawns and thoughtfully placed mulch beds.



Another critical measure is to maintain humidity levels inside your home. Excess moisture can lead to fungal issues and damage to the structure. Putting money in a moisture absorber can be advantageous, especially in areas known for high humidity. Consistently monitoring indoor humidity levels and using exhaust fans in high-moisture areas like kitchens and bathrooms can help maintain your home dry and lower the risk of future water issues.


In conclusion, it's crucial to conduct regular inspections of your plumbing and appliances. Look for drips in areas such as under sinks, around toilets, and at the base of appliances like washing machines and dishwashers. Prompt identification of possible problems can stop small issues from escalating into serious water damage, ensuring peace of mind in your home.
